Vehicle Speed Sensor

To accurately calculate distance travelled based on vehicle speed, it is necessary to take into consideration speed coefficient differences that are dependent upon vehicle type. To solve this problem, Panasonic uses original software processing for fully automatic distance correction.
Automatic Intersection Zoom*
As you travel towards your designated destination, the map display automatically zooms in 300 metres before you reach an intersection where a turn needs to be made. Also shown is the distance remaining to the turn, the direction of the turn and the road to be taken after turning. Map instructions are supplemented by voice prompts. If turns occur in rapid succession, the display will show the distance to each succeeding turn, direction of each turn and road names.
*This feature operates only on ordinary roads, not on motorways.
Six Smart Ways to Find a Destination
Panasonics DVD navigation systems give you a choice of six easy and effective ways to search for your destination and programme a route. You can search by: 1) Address (street, city, or post code); 2) Intersection (i.e. main street and cross street); 3) POI (Points of Interest) category, such as amusement parks, hotels, or restaurants; 4) History, meaning any one of the last 100 destinations to which you have previously driven; 5) Marked Point, which is any one of up to 100 places you can input into the systems memory to be marked on the map with an icon; and 6) variablespeed joystick Map Scroll in eight directions. If you start by inputting a city, the CN-DV2300 will show you a list of up to ten cities you have selected most recently. If the city you want is on the list, then theres no need to input the name again, letter-by-letter.

5.1-Channel Dolby Digital/dts Surround
Many film titles on DVD Video discs* have their soundtracks encoded in Dolby Digital, the surround system used for the original films shown in cinemas. With 5.1-channel Dolby Digital, six channels of sound are digitally recordedL&R front, L&R surround, centre, as well as a subwoofer channel. Because these are discrete channels, you clearly hear sound effects in motion, not only left-right and front-rear, but also diagonallylike you would expect to experience from a movie cinema sound system. Copyright Protection

The "SD" in SD Memory Card stands for "Secure Digital," referring to the high-level security functions this media uses for copyright protection. With the development of electronic media distribution services for musical content, this protection encourages content creators and providers to make available high-quality material for you to
record and enjoy in the SD Memory Card format.

Simplified Disc Navigation To make it easy to find a specific song, files can be grouped and organised into folders by music genre and/or artist before they are transferred to disc.* You can then use the display on your Panasonic MP3-compatible CD player/receiver to scroll through folders or files until you come to your selection. The extra-large display on the CQ-DFX972 can actually show both folders and files at the same time, up to 31 characters long. You can also locate a song in a particular folder or across the entire disc with intro scan (playback of the first 10 seconds of each selection), or leave it all up to your Panasonic car stereo with random play.
*Players can read up to eight folders and a combined total of up to 254 files and folders. Files and folders on a disc beyond this limit will not be read.

Full-Function 1-Chip DAB LSI
In a remarkable feat of semiconductor design and fabrication, Panasonic engineers have integrated all of the main DAB tuner circuitry onto a single chip. This LSI contains the DAB receivers OFDM demodulator, error correction, MPEG audio decoding and other digital signal processing circuits. Thanks to this large-scale integration technology, you enjoy greater reliability in a more compact package.

Anti-Shock Floating Mechanism
The critical laser pickup and disc loading mechanism incorporated into Panasonic CD changers are isolated in a floating suspension. Two suspension coils and four rubber-plussilicone dampers help absorb external vibrations.
Ultra-compact design for in-cabin or boot mounting.
A CD changers pickup can temporarily skip off track when your car hits a bump in the road. To compensate for this, Panasonics sophisticated anti-shock memory stores up to 10 seconds of music ahead of time, allowing the pickup to return and continue before playback is affected by jolts or vibration.
